What are the different crochet patterns?

There are many different types of crochet stitches. A few stitches are chain, single, half double, double, treble, puff, cluster, popcorn, and many others. Stitches can be worked by themselves are in combinations to make various patterns. Crochet can be worked in straight lines or in the round.

What is a crochet pattern?

Crochet patterns are worked in either rows or rounds (rnds). Each pattern will specify whether you are working in rows, rounds or a combination of both. Most crochet patterns are rated according to level of difficulty, including beginner, easy, intermediate and advanced.

How do you crochet a hat?

Crochet in the round means to crochet a small circle – the base for your hat (the part at the very top). When you pull the hook through, you’ll have started a second row that is adjacent to the first, in a spiral. As you crochet your hat, make sure that you continue to crochet in a spiral.

What is the fastest crochet stitch?

One stitch, to be exact. The actual record holder for world’s fastest crocheter is Lisa Gentry who set the official record on June 25, 2005. To set the Guinness World record, Lisa crocheted 28 treble crochet stitches in one minute.

What is stocking cap?

A stocking cap is a tight-fitting knit cap worn in cold weather. It is typically made of wool, synthetic fibers, or fleece, and it is a fairly easy knitting project. This garment is the unofficial national hat of Canada, where it is called a tuque or toque, as the cold winters in that country make it a lifesaver.

What is a knitting cap?

A knit cap is a clothing accessory that is crafted through the use of knitting techniques and worn on the head. The cap is constructed with yarn or some other thread and can be of any weight or thickness.

  • What size is a newborn baby hat?

    Newborn: Hat Height 5 inches; Hat width (when on a flat surface) 6.50 inches. The finished circumference of this hat is 13″ around and it will stretch approximately 1.5 – 2 inches to fit an average size Newborn Head.
